Original NVD Description
A vulnerability was identified in zevorn rt-claw up to 0.2.0. This affects the function claw_net_get/claw_net_post of the file claw/tools/tool_net.c of the component http_request. Such manipulation of the argument url leads to server-side request forgery. The attack may be performed from remote. The exploit is publicly available and might be used. The project was informed of the problem early through an issue report but has not responded yet.
